Company Overview
Elevated is an international consultancy dedicated to supporting responsible business through professional education, leadership development and business growth strategies. Elevated's suite of specialist products and services equip business leaders with the knowledge, skills, and confidence they need to sustain their success and elevate their impact.

Speaker's Bureau Information

Speaker Bio
A former association chief executive, for 15 years Andrew held c-suite positions in non-profit and third sector bodies across the UK. Since 2016 he has worked as a specialist in non-profit leadership, working internationally to provide expert support in leadership development, business strategy, and good governance. With a proven pedigree in understanding and maximizing business dynamics, engagement, and growth, he volunteers as the Executive Director of the Institute of Association Leadership; is the founder of the Cambridge Governance Symposium; the author of the NETpositive Governance™ model; editor of the IAL Almanac; co-author of "compass: the systems map for association leadership"; and is co-host of the transatlantic podcast Association Transformation.

Topic 2
The bottleneck of human thought: Non-profits and the attention economy
Topic 2 Description
When he defined the concept of "attention economics" in 1971, Nobel Laureate Herbert A. Simon wrote that ".a wealth of information creates a poverty of attention...". 50 vears later, and in a data-rich world, the overwhelming wealth of information available to us means a dearth of something else, i.e. the scarcity of whatever it is that information consumes - our attention. In this session, Andrew defines the concept and leads an exploration on how non-profit
leadership teams need to understand, respond to, and flourish within the attention economy.
Topic 3
The professional privilege of generative governance
Topic 3 Description
Non-profit governance is often viewed as a burden, interpreted as somewhat of a poisoned chalice, with the kudos of a board position offset by the challenges of decision-making and the weight of responsibility for the success (or otherwise) of an organisation. But it is an exciting time to lead a non-profit and governance represents one of the most exciting components of non-profit leadership. Engaging in creative discussion, adding specialist insights, contributing professional expertise, and supporting the long-term sustainability of the organisation is not a burden and Andrew explains how it can and should be welcomed as a professional privilege, one that people should be clambering to enjoy.
